Introduction to AI Investment
The integ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) into various sectors has transformed the way businesses operate, creating new avenues for investment. As AI technology continues to evolve, investors are looking for ways to capitalize on this trend.
Key AI Trends
Several trends are driving the growth of AI, including machine learning, natural language processing, and computer vision. These technologies are being applied in industries such as healthcare, finance, and transportation, leading to increased efficiency and innovation.
Investment Opportunities
Investors can gain exposure to the AI sector through a variety of stocks, including those of companies that specialize in AI software, hardware, and services. Some of the key players in the AI space include NVIDIA, Alphabet, and Microsoft.
- NVIDIA: A leader in AI computing hardware, NVIDIA's graphics processing units (GPUs) are used in a wide range of AI applications, from gaming to autonomous vehicles.
- Alphabet: The parent company of Google, Alphabet is a major player in the AI space, with applications in search, advertising, and cloud computing.
- Microsoft: Microsoft is investing heavily in AI, with a focus on enterprise software and cloud computing.
Risks and Challenges
While the potential for AI investment is significant, there are also risks and challenges to consider. These include regulatory uncertainty, cyber security threats, and the potential for job displacement.
